-
Total de itens
160 -
Registro em
-
Última visita
Tudo que Hemptt postou
-
dev [Resolvido] COMO FAZER UMA ENTITY NAO TOMAR DANO? ENTRE AQUI!
pergunta respondeu ao Hemptt de Hemptt em Dúvidas resolvidas
Olha o edit que eu coloquei e ve se consegues me ajudar! -
dev [Resolvido] COMO FAZER UMA ENTITY NAO TOMAR DANO? ENTRE AQUI!
uma questão postou Hemptt Dúvidas resolvidas
Queria o código, da entity não tomar dano e tambem, ela não poder se mover... Meu Código: package Menu; import org.bukkit.Sound; import org.bukkit.command.Command; import org.bukkit.command.CommandExecutor; import org.bukkit.command.CommandSender; import org.bukkit.entity.EntityType; import org.bukkit.entity.Player; import org.bukkit.entity.Villager; import org.bukkit.event.EventHandler; import org.bukkit.event.Listener; import org.bukkit.event.entity.EntityDeathEvent; import org.bukkit.event.player.PlayerInteractEntityEvent; public class Entity implements CommandExecutor, Listener{ String under = "§7Under§bMC §7» "; @Override public boolean onCommand(CommandSender sender, Command cmd, String label, String[] args) { if (!(sender instanceof Player)){ sender.sendMessage(under + "§cVoce so pode executar o comando no servidor!"); return true; } Player p = (Player)sender; if (cmd.getName().equalsIgnoreCase("geraldo")){ if(p.hasPermission("use.geraldo")){ Villager v = (Villager) p.getWorld().spawnEntity(p.getLocation(), EntityType.VILLAGER); String nome = "§7Under§bMC §a» §7Geraldo§a!"; v.setCustomName(nome); v.setCustomNameVisible(true); p.sendMessage("§a» §7Você spawnou o geraldo!"); p.playSound(p.getLocation(), Sound.EXPLODE, 150F, 150F); }else { p.sendMessage("§c» §7Você nao tem permissao para usar esse comando!"); p.playSound(p.getLocation(), Sound.EXPLODE, 150F, 150F); } } return false; } @EventHandler public void Geraldao(PlayerInteractEntityEvent e){ if(e.getRightClicked() instanceof Villager){ Villager villager = (Villager) e.getRightClicked(); if(villager.getCustomName().equalsIgnoreCase("§7Under§bMC §a» §7Geraldo§a!")){ e.getPlayer().sendMessage("§c» §7Nosso §cCEO §7está desenvolvendo o plugin, brevemente será lançado!"); e.setCancelled(true); } } } } @Edit Como removo essa entity com o comando "/removeentty" ? -
É 10/10, As paredes ficou um pouco estranhas
-
[Resolvido] Como colocar DELAY em um comando?
pergunta respondeu ao Hemptt de Hemptt em Dúvidas resolvidas
Ok, próximas dúvidas crio o tópico na area de Java, cara tu fala achando que eu sei fazer tudo, mais não é bem assim... -
[Resolvido] Como colocar DELAY em um comando?
pergunta respondeu ao Hemptt de Hemptt em Dúvidas resolvidas
Vi esse video 3 vezes e não entendi sinceramente! -
Como coloco um delay de 3 segundos no meu plugin de /report? Se puderem explicar agradeço package Comandos; import java.util.ArrayList; import org.bukkit.Bukkit; import org.bukkit.Sound; import org.bukkit.command.Command; import org.bukkit.command.CommandExecutor; import org.bukkit.command.CommandSender; import org.bukkit.entity.Player; public class Report implements CommandExecutor{ String under = "§7Under§bMC §7» "; @Override public boolean onCommand(CommandSender sender, Command cmd, String label, String[] args) { if (!(sender instanceof Player)){ sender.sendMessage(under + "§cVoce so pode executar o comando no servidor!"); return true; } Player p = (Player)sender; if (cmd.getName().equalsIgnoreCase("report")){ if (args.length == 0){ p.sendMessage(under + "Use: §e/report <nick> <motivo>"); return true; } Player t = Bukkit.getPlayer(args[0]); if (t == null){ p.sendMessage(under + "Esse player nao existe ou esta offline!"); } else { String msg = ""; for (int i = 1; i < args.length; i++){ if (i == args.length - 1){ msg = msg + args[i]; } else { msg = msg + args[i] + " "; } for (Player s : Bukkit.getOnlinePlayers()){ if (s.hasPermission("use.report")){ s.playSound(p.getLocation(), Sound.EXPLODE, 150F, 150F); s.sendMessage("§c------------------------"); s.sendMessage(under + "§cReport:"); s.sendMessage(""); s.sendMessage("§aReportado: §7" + t.getName()); s.sendMessage("§aMotivo: §7" + msg); s.sendMessage("§aVitima: §7" + p.getName()); s.sendMessage(""); s.sendMessage("§c------------------------"); p.sendMessage(under + "Você reportou §b" + t.getName() + ". §7Motivo: §b" + msg); p.playSound(p.getLocation(), Sound.EXPLODE, 150F, 150F); } } } } } return false; } }
-
Tem como adicionar permissões tipo caiu em um item ai adiciona uma permissão?
-
@EDIT Pode me passar a schematic da arvore? ta perfeita *-*
-
HELP ME!
-
Não...
-
Vlw pela disposição, mas quero que alguém me ajude, ou, mande um mini tutorial explicando como que faz!
-
Bom, estou querendo começar um projeto, um plugin de kitpvp, e como todos vocês sabem ninguém nasce sabendo de tudo, e como sou novo em programação venho pedir a ajuda de vocês! Podem fazer um "Mini Tutorial" de como fazer o comando /tag, igual desses plugins desses plugins de kitpvp? Agradeço se puderem fazer isso Pra quem não entendeu - Comandos: /tag {nome da tag que tiver no código, se ele tiver permissão ele poderá pegar a tag se não tiver mandara uma msg que não possui permissão }
-
Eu li, viado -q
-
Boa, bom tuto =D
-
[Resolvido] FOR & WHILE - QUAL A DIFERENÇA?
pergunta respondeu ao Hemptt de Hemptt em Dúvidas resolvidas
Tendi, vlw vei, se tu puder me adicionar no skype, preciso meio que um "professor" para tirar minhas duvidas, skype(HouphissDesign) -
Vi uns videos e eu queria se tem ou não e qual é diferença de while & for Preciso de um professor skype(HouphissDesign)
-
Vlw tava precisando!
-
Coloca mais prints, ta daora, 9.5 só pq não é meu -.-
-
[Resolvido] [Help] Lista de lojas dos vips , ajuda
pergunta respondeu ao AlexHackers de Hemptt em Dúvidas resolvidas
Como faço esse quadrado? para citar os códigos? -
Eu quero se for free -.-
-
Só utilizar o comando do programinha...
-
Quando vou tentar conectar no meu servidor da isso - http://prntscr.com/bugovf